in childhood. Without a specific diagnostic test, KD can be diagnosed when other known
diagnoses are excluded and at least five of the following six clinical criteria Or four of six
clinical criteria associated with coronary aneurysm formation are met:(1) fever lasting 5 days
or more not responding to antibiotics,(2) bilateral nonpurulent conjunctival congestion,(3)
one or more changes of lips and oral cavity (dry, red, fissured lips; reddened oropharyngeal …
